2007 Cadillac STS V8 Cylinder 6 Misfire


Recommended Posts

I have a 2007 Cadillac STS, 4.6 Northstar V8. I have a code on that says cylinder/injector # 6 misfire (Code PO 206) When I took it to a shop they said that is not grounding properly & it is pulsing but they could give me no other advice on where to proceed. I have only had this car a week or two and you can clearly see where someone has tried to probe the wires and track down the problem.
I have just changed an O2 Sensor (Right Side, Downstream), and a purge valve solenoid since the problems have started. It runs really rough, The engine light now flashes and the Traction control light comes on while it is messing up. At first it was occasional but now it is constant.

Any advice?

First thought would be bad #6 plug and/or coil-pack; hopefully it is not cylinder related (i.e., ring/valve/cylinder itself).
